Arqiva stays top of the pops with Bubble Hits deal
29th Jun 2006
- Arqiva to provide direct-to-home (DTH) services for the UK's first ad-free music TV channel
- £1 million-plus deal over five-year term
- DTH solution to include co-location services and uplinking facilities
Arqiva's Satellite Media Solutions has secured a deal with Creative Sounds Ltd to provide direct-to-home (DTH) services for Bubble Hits, the UK's first ad-free music TV channel. The deal - worth over £1 million across a five-year period - will see Arqiva providing co-location and uplinking facilities for the music channel from one of its UK sites. Bubble Hits is due to launch on Sky in August this year, targeting a 16-24 year old audience.
Arqiva's DTH solution for Bubble Hits encompasses co-location services, uplinking and space segment on the Eurobird satellite as well as remote access facilities. The company's fully managed solution also ensures a consistent level of service allowing Arqiva to identify and resolve any technical issues which may arise.
